首页
熊猫办公下载
文件下载
根据地址查询经纬度
登录 / 注册
一级分类:
安全技术
存储
操作系统
服务器应用
行业
课程资源
开发技术
考试认证
数据库
网络技术
信息化
移动开发
云计算
大数据
跨平台
音视频
游戏开发
人工智能
区块链
二级分类:
数据库设计pdf
数据库设计是信息系统开发过程中的关键环节,它涉及到数据的组织、存储和管理,为应用程序提供高效、稳定的数据支持。
这份“数据库设计pdf”文件很可能是关于数据库系统的基础理论、设计方法以及最佳实践的综合指南。
下面我们将深入探讨数据库设计的重要知识点。
数据库设计的核心概念包括实体(Entities)、属性(Attributes)、键(Keys)和关系(Relationships)。
实体代表现实世界中的对象或概念,属性则是描述实体的特征,键是用来唯一标识实体的属性组合,而关系则连接了不同实体之间的关联。
1.**数据库模式**:数据库模式是数据库的逻辑结构,包括数据表、字段、索引等,通常以ER(实体关系)图的形式表示。
在设计时,需要确定实体、属性、键和关系,并确保它们满足第一范式(1NF)、第二范式(2NF)和第三范式(3NF),以避免数据冗余和异常。
2.**关系数据库模型**:这是最常见的数据库模型,由一组二维表组成,每个表都有一个唯一的表名,通过主键和外键实现表间的关联。
SQL(StructuredQueryLanguage)是用于操作关系数据库的标准语言。
3.**范式理论**:范式是数据库规范化的过程,旨在减少数据冗余和提高数据一致性。
除了前面提到的1NF、2NF和3NF,还有更高级的BCNF(巴斯-科德范式)和4NF(第四范式)等。
4.**数据库设计步骤**:数据库设计通常包括需求分析、概念设计(ER图)、逻辑设计(关系模式)、物理设计(表结构、索引、分区等)以及数据库实施和维护。
5.**性能优化**:在设计阶段就需要考虑数据库的性能,包括合理选择数据类型、索引策略、查询优化等。
例如,适当使用聚集索引和非聚集索引可以提升查询速度。
6.**安全性与权限管理**:数据库设计中,安全性和权限控制是不可或缺的部分,包括用户账号管理、角色权限分配、访问控制列表(ACL)等,确保数据的安全性和隐私。
7.**备份与恢复**:数据库设计需包含备份策略,以应对意外的数据丢失,如定期全备、增量备份和差异备份。
同时,理解如何进行灾难恢复计划(DRP)也是必要的。
8.**分布式数据库**:随着大数据和云计算的发展,分布式数据库成为趋势。
设计时需考虑数据分片、复制、分布式事务处理等复杂问题。
9.**NoSQL数据库**:除了传统的SQL数据库,NoSQL数据库如MongoDB、Cassandra等提供了非关系型、可扩展的解决方案,适用于处理大规模、高并发的数据场景。
10.**数据库设计工具**:如MySQLWorkbench、OracleSQLDeveloper等工具能辅助进行数据库设计和管理,提高工作效率。
“数据库设计pdf”可能涵盖了这些内容,通过学习可以深入了解数据库设计的各个方面,无论是对初学者还是经验丰富的开发者,都是宝贵的参考资料。
2025/12/4 5:02:17
54.41MB
1
dbeaver-ce-7.3.4-x86_64-setup.exe
适用于开发人员,SQL程序员,数据库管理员和分析人员的免费多平台数据库工具。
支持任何具有JDBC驱动程序的数据库(基本上意味着-ANY数据库)。
EE版本还支持非JDBC数据源(MongoDB,Cassandra,Couchbase,Redis,BigTable,DynamoDB等)。
具有很多功能,包括元数据编辑器,SQL编辑器,丰富的数据编辑器,ERD,数据导出/导入/迁移,SQL执行计划等。
基于Eclipse平台。
使用插件架构,并为以下数据库提供附加功能:MySQL/MariaDB,PostgreSQL,Greenplum,Oracle,DB2LUW,Exasol等等。
2025/4/18 6:26:25
88.07MB
数据库
数据库工具
dbeaver
最新版本
1
GoCrawler-源码
GoCrawler卡桑德拉命令Cassandra执行SQLdockerexec-itsome-cassandrabashroot@6405f1f27115:/#cqlshCassandra列表键空间cqlsh>desckeyspaces;Cassandra使用键空间cqlsh>useptt_keyspace;卡桑德拉清单表cqlsh:ptt_keyspace>desctables;Cassandra列表表架构cqlsh:ptt_keyspace>desctablearticle;卡桑德拉列表表记录cqlsh:ptt_keyspace>select*fromarticle;卡桑德拉计数表记录cqlsh:ptt_keyspace>selectCOUNT(*)fromarticle;Rabbitmq命令运行Rabb
2025/3/1 7:50:54
48KB
Go
1
Springboot+Mybatis+Maven+Oracle+Cassandra+事务(Aop)+定时任务实现
本文将通过示例介绍Springboot,mybatis,maven,oracle,cassandra,aop事务,定时任务等框架的集成,因此业务不会复杂,供学习使用。
2025/2/7 17:08:38
80KB
Springboot
mybatis
oracle
cassandra
1
windows系统下cassandra的安装方法.zip
记录的时安装方法,让你少走弯路
2024/6/5 12:12:46
825B
cassandra
1
treeDMS-2.3.4.zip
基于web的方式对数据库进行管理维护,支持MySQL,MariaDB,Oracle,PostgreSQL,SQLServer,DB2,MongoDB,Hive,SAPHANA,Sybase,Caché,Informix,clickHouse,cassandra,达梦DM,金仓Kinbase,神通,南大GBase等数据库。
支持异构数据库间的数据自动抽取,同步,汇聚。
内有试用方法。
2023/12/19 21:05:39
95.97MB
数据库同步
MySQL
Oracle
远程管理
1
Packt.Mastering.Apache.Cassandra.3rd.Edition
Build,manage,andconfigurehigh-performing,reliableNoSQLdatabaseforyourapplicationswithCassandraKeyFeaturesWriteprogramsmoreefficientlyusingCassandra'sfeatureswiththehelpofexamplesConfigureCassandraandfine-tuneitsparametersdependingonyourneedsIntegrateCassandradatabasewithApacheSparkandbuildstrongdataanalyticspipeline
2023/8/9 8:14:39
11.98MB
Cassandra
1
dbeaver-ce-7.3.3-x86_64-setup.exe
Freemulti-platformdatabasetoolfordevelopers,SQLprogra妹妹ers,databaseadministratorsandanalysts.SupportsanydatabasewhichhasJDBCdriver(whichbasicallymeans-ANYdatabase).EEversionalsosupportsnon-JDBCdatasources(MongoDB,Cassandra,Couchbase,Redis,BigTable,DynamoDB,etc).
2023/4/25 6:18:50
88.06MB
数据库
1
Thingsboard入门指南.ppt
设备接入:MQTT、CoAP、HTTP规则引擎:配置设备消息的处理流程核心服务:设备认证、规则和插件、租户和客户、小组件和仪表盘、告警和事件服务端API网关:RESTAPI、websocketsActor模型:次要用于并发集群模式:Zookeeper用于服务发现,一致性哈希保证消息的扩展性和可用性。
安全:SSL用于HTTP和MQTT设备认证:Token和X.509第三方工具:AKKA【Actor】、Zookeeper、gRPC、Cassandra
2021/4/9 12:41:35
1.27MB
MQTT
CoAP
物联网
HTTP
1
Mastering.Apache.Cassandra.2nd.Edition.1784392618
Title:MasteringApacheCassandra,2ndEditionAuthor:NishantNeerajLength:322pagesEdition:2Language:EnglishPublisher:PacktPublishingPublicationDate:2015-02-27ISBN-10:1784392618ISBN-13:9781784392611ThebookisaimedatintermediatedeveloperswithanunderstandingofcoredatabaseconceptsandwanttobecomeamasterimplementingCassandrafortheirapplication.TableofContentsChapter1.QuickStartChapter2.CassandraArchitectureChapter3.EffectiveCQLChapter4.DeployingaClusterChapter5.PerformanceTuningChapter6.ManagingaCluster–Scaling,NodeRepair,andBackupChapter7.MonitoringChapter8.IntegrationwithHadoop
2020/3/21 20:06:18
3.82MB
Apache
Cassandra
1
钉钉无人值守自动打卡脚本 永不迟到的神器 安卓和苹果教程
New!
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03
15KB
钉钉
钉钉打卡
个人信息
点我去登录or注册
|
微信登录
一言
热门下载
双系统双频伪距单点定位程序
数据库系统概论第五版
中科院考博英语2009-2018年试题及答案解析(十五套436面).pdf
Docker构建tomcat镜像jdk1.8+tomcat9.zip
飘逸传世引擎源代码
ABAQUS金属非稳态和稳态切削过程的模拟分析_张东进.pdf
HTML5+CSS3中文参考手册(3手册)chm版中文参考手册打包
新升级版TP5商城小程序源码+公众号版+h5一整套源码V3.zip
StimulsoftReports2020.1.1License.rar
CNS2_CN_VW_P0095D_0332.7z
KEPServerEXV6.7.zip
几何画板课件350套.zip
R9390系列BIOS修改和风扇调速工具
ENVI去云补丁Haze_tool文件及其使用说明和安装方法
vue项目demo(asp.netmvc5+vue2.5)
最新下载
智慧城市安全体系标准(意见稿)
usbcan(c#实例)
linux音乐播放器
LeetCode:地里刨食的野猪-源码
JavaRSA,MD5string,MD5File,DES,ELGamal算法实现+RSA数字签名
prius电机ansoft仿真
滴水逆向教材及笔记
自编PID控制水箱液位
openwrtmt7688/mt7628pwmdriver驱动
ssm代码生成器,后台代码一键生成器
ParticlePath
基于简单IO口的显示语音播放器
PInetwork项目介绍.pdf
IFRS和USGAAP辨析汇总.pdf
数学建模教程matlab数学建模模型编程实例
其他资源
PSS/E动态仿真完全手册
Mysql_妹妹m_rpm.rar
GameProgra妹妹ingPatterns(中文版)
dns2tcp官方最新版+可用的客户端(DNS隧道转发TCP连接的工具)
madhuweb:学习网页汇合-源码
python实现天气查询,还添加了界面,可直接运行和打包
while_loop.py
android一个简单的阅读器源码
快速理解ClickHouse原理
校园bbs网站
蓝桥杯单片机历年真题锦(含二到九届的真题与题目)史上最全
计算机操作零碎课件(考研)
matlab边缘图像检测几种算法GUI界面
Norflashcontroller代码设计和文档说明,wishbone总线接口的
视觉slamMATLAB仿真
基于颜色的matlab代码
abaqus经典例题集
第二学期教育教学工作总结.doc
【桌面零碎】51单片机+DAC0832组成的三角波发生器电路(包含源代码和Proteus仿真电路)
secoclient_3.0.3.21.zip